在现代软件开发中,连点器(如按钮、滑块等)的性能优化是一个关键问题,连点器的调用速度直接影响用户体验和应用性能,本文将探讨如何通过合理的设计和优化连点器来提高其调用效率。
一、连点器的基本概念
连点器是一种用户界面元素,通常用于触发特定的操作或执行某种功能,它们常见的类型包括按钮、链接、滑块、复选框等,连点器的主要目的是简化用户交互过程,让用户能够方便地完成任务。
二、连点器调用策略
2.1 避免频繁点击
频繁点击会导致系统资源占用过高,影响用户体验,开发者应尽量避免在短时间内连续点击同一个连点器,可以通过以下方法来减少点击频率:
使用延迟:在用户按下连点器后,设置一个延迟时间,使得用户有足够的时间思考是否需要继续点击。
启用双击事件:如果可能,可以为连点器添加双击事件,这样即使用户快速点击两次,也只会执行一次操作。
2.2 利用缓存机制
对于一些简单的连点器,可以考虑使用缓存机制来提高调用效率,在用户第一次点击连点器时,将其状态存储到缓存中;以后再次点击时,直接从缓存中获取状态进行处理,而不需要重新计算。
2.3 使用异步编程
对于耗时较长的连点器操作,可以考虑使用异步编程技术,这不仅可以提高应用程序的整体响应速度,还可以使用户在操作过程中感受到系统的流畅性。
三、连点器调用实践
3.1 确定连点器的功能
明确连点器的功能,不同的功能要求对连点器的调用方式有所不同,一个简单的“提交”按钮可能只需要一次点击即可执行操作,而一个复杂的“搜索”按钮则可能需要多次点击才能完全展开所有选项。
3.2 优化连点器的布局
合理的布局可以显著提升连点器的调用效率,可以使用栅格系统或其他布局工具来组织连点器,确保它们在不同尺寸屏幕上都能正确显示和使用。
3.3 测试和反馈
定期测试连点器的性能,并根据反馈进行调整,可以通过收集用户的使用数据和反馈信息,了解哪些连点器需要改进,从而进一步优化连点器的调用策略。
连点器的调用效率是提高用户体验和应用性能的重要因素,通过合理的设计和优化连点器的调用策略,可以显著提升连点器的响应速度和用户体验,开发者应该关注连点器的功能、布局和性能,不断优化以实现更好的用户体验。